CITY OF SAUK RAPIDS

NOTICE OF FILING

FOR THE 2020 STATE PRIMARY ELECTION

Notice is hereby given that a Municipal Primary Election will be held in the City of Sauk Rapids, Benton County, on Tuesday, August 11, 2020 for the purpose of electing candidates for the offices listed below. The filing period for these offices begins at 8:00 AM on Tuesday, May 19, 2020 until 5:00 PM on Tuesday, June 2, 2020. Due to the COVID-19 global pandemic, City Offices may still be closed to the public at the time of filing. If City offices are still closed for COVID-19 reasons at the time of filing, please call City Clerk, Ross Olson, at (320) 258-5302 to schedule a time in which to file in person. Please note, social distancing and other safety measures will be in place to prevent the spread of COVID-19. Filing information and forms is available on the City’s website at www.ci.sauk-rapids.mn.us

_____________________________________________________________

CITY OFFICES

One (1) Mayoral Seat-Elected at Large-Four (4) Year Terms

Two (2) City Council Seats – Elected at Large – Four (4) Year Terms

__________________________________________________________________ _

Filing of Affidavits of Candidacy for City Offices shall be at the City Clerk’s Office, Sauk Rapids Government Center-City Hall, 250 Summit Ave N, Sauk Rapids, Minnesota, 56379 from 8:00 AM on Tuesday, May 19, 2020 until 5:00 PM on Tuesday, June 2, 2020. Please contact Ross Olson, City Clerk, at (320) 258-5302 to schedule a time in which to file in person.
